CSU prepares for students and O Week in Bathurst

14 FEBRUARY 2012

Approximately 1 000 new students, many accompanied by parents and supporters, will start to arrive at Charles Sturt University (CSU) in Bathurst on the weekend in the lead-up to Orientation Week 2012  from Monday 20 February. The Head of CSU in Bathurst, Mr Col Sharp, said, “This is an exciting time for everyone at Charles Sturt University as we welcome new students and their parents. We will pay particular attention to helping the students settle into university life so they can enjoy their time here and make the most of the opportunities higher education offers.” The students will register between 12noon to 4pm on Saturday 18 February at the CD Blake Auditorium (building E1, the gymnasium) for their on-campus accommodation. After the accommodation check-in, all are invited to attend a 4.30pm information session about student life on-campus at CSU, followed by a barbeque. Later that week, approximately 1 800 continuing students will return to CSU in Bathurst. Many will check-in to on-campus accommodation on Friday 24 February for the start of Session One of the new academic year on Monday 27 February. For its first intake this year, the University expects about 3 000 new domestic students and 260 new international students on its NSW campuses, and a further 5 000 new domestic distance education students.
